一种DNS资源记录的去中心化存储系统及其实现方法

    公开(公告)号:CN110061838B

    公开(公告)日:2022-07-19

    申请号:CN201910350269.5

    申请日:2019-04-28

    Applicant: 广州大学

    Abstract: 本发明公开了一种DNS资源记录的去中心化存储系统及其实现方法,该系统包括:链上存储层,利用智能合约存储DNS资源记录、索引外部存储中关键DNS资源记录以及溯源DNS资源记录;链下存储层,采用IPFS存储DNS资源记录,每个IPFS节点对应一标识身份的哈希地址,将标识身份的哈希地址和记录信息的哈希值存储在区块链中,确保资源记录的真实性和完整性;用户层包括DNS管理员和DNS用户,前者负责DNS数据库信息注册和更新,同步DNS关键数据到外部存储中,并利用智能合约将相关信息写入区块中,后者通过DNS客户端查询域名对应的资源记录,并查询区块链和外部存储中的记录,验证记录的真实性和完整性。

    一种DNS资源记录的去中心化存储系统及其实现、信息检索方法

    公开(公告)号:CN110061838A

    公开(公告)日:2019-07-26

    申请号:CN201910350269.5

    申请日:2019-04-28

    Applicant: 广州大学

    Abstract: 本发明公开了一种DNS资源记录的去中心化存储系统及其实现、信息检索方法,该系统包括:链上存储层,利用智能合约存储DNS资源记录、索引外部存储中关键DNS资源记录以及溯源DNS资源记录;链下存储层,采用IPFS存储DNS资源记录,每个IPFS节点对应一标识身份的哈希地址,将标识身份的哈希地址和记录信息的哈希值存储在区块链中,确保资源记录的真实性和完整性;用户层包括DNS管理员和DNS用户,前者负责DNS数据库信息注册和更新,同步DNS关键数据到外部存储中,并利用智能合约将相关信息写入区块中,后者通过DNS客户端查询域名对应的资源记录,并查询区块链和外部存储中的记录,验证记录的真实性和完整性。

    一种去中心化的跨信任域认证方法及系统

    公开(公告)号:CN110061851A

    公开(公告)日:2019-07-26

    申请号:CN201910351272.9

    申请日:2019-04-28

    Applicant: 广州大学

    Abstract: 本发明公开了一种去中心化的跨信任域认证方法及系统,该方法包括如下步骤:步骤S1,在联盟链的基础上构建区块链网络,将各个信任域的根CA设为区块链的验证节点,联盟链中存储着所有根CA共识的数字证书的哈希值;步骤S2,所述区块链网络中的各用户向信任域内的根CA申请、更新或注销区块链证书;步骤S3,当用户进行跨信任域认证时,将区块链中存储的用户哈希值和认证时用户提供的证书哈希值相比较,如果两者相同说明该用户提供的证书合法,否则丢弃用户的跨域请求,通过本发明,可解决传统跨信任域认证模型的管理、去中心化和维护方面的问题。

Patent Agency Ranking